syntax = "proto3";

package android.service.battery;

option java_multiple_files = true;
option java_outer_classname = "BatteryServiceProto";

message BatteryServiceDumpProto {
    enum BatteryPlugged {
        BATTERY_PLUGGED_NONE = 0;
        BATTERY_PLUGGED_AC = 1;
        BATTERY_PLUGGED_USB = 2;
        BATTERY_PLUGGED_WIRELESS = 4;
    }
    enum BatteryStatus {
        BATTERY_STATUS_INVALID = 0;
        BATTERY_STATUS_UNKNOWN = 1;
        BATTERY_STATUS_CHARGING = 2;
        BATTERY_STATUS_DISCHARGING = 3;
        BATTERY_STATUS_NOT_CHARGING = 4;
        BATTERY_STATUS_FULL = 5;
    }
    enum BatteryHealth {
        BATTERY_HEALTH_INVALID = 0;
        BATTERY_HEALTH_UNKNOWN = 1;
        BATTERY_HEALTH_GOOD = 2;
        BATTERY_HEALTH_OVERHEAT = 3;
        BATTERY_HEALTH_DEAD = 4;
        BATTERY_HEALTH_OVER_VOLTAGE = 5;
        BATTERY_HEALTH_UNSPECIFIED_FAILURE = 6;
        BATTERY_HEALTH_COLD = 7;
    }

    // If true: UPDATES STOPPED -- use 'reset' to restart
    bool are_updates_stopped = 1;
    // Plugged status of power sources
    BatteryPlugged plugged = 2;
    // Max current in microamperes
    int32 max_charging_current = 3;
    // Max voltage
    int32 max_charging_voltage = 4;
    // Battery capacity in microampere-hours
    int32 charge_counter = 5;
    // Charging status
    BatteryStatus status = 6;
    // Battery health
    BatteryHealth health = 7;
    // True if the battery is present
    bool is_present = 8;
    // Charge level, from 0 through "scale" inclusive
    int32 level = 9;
    // The maximum value for the charge level
    int32 scale = 10;
    // Battery voltage in millivolts
    int32 voltage = 11;
    // Battery temperature in tenths of a degree Centigrade
    int32 temperature = 12;
    // The type of battery installed, e.g. "Li-ion"
    string technology = 13;
}

    private void dumpProto(FileDescriptor fd) {
        final ProtoOutputStream proto = new ProtoOutputStream(fd);

        synchronized (mLock) {
            proto.write(BatteryServiceDumpProto.ARE_UPDATES_STOPPED, mUpdatesStopped);
            int batteryPluggedValue = BatteryServiceDumpProto.BATTERY_PLUGGED_NONE;
            if (mBatteryProps.chargerAcOnline) {
                batteryPluggedValue = BatteryServiceDumpProto.BATTERY_PLUGGED_AC;
            } else if (mBatteryProps.chargerUsbOnline) {
                batteryPluggedValue = BatteryServiceDumpProto.BATTERY_PLUGGED_USB;
            } else if (mBatteryProps.chargerWirelessOnline) {
                batteryPluggedValue = BatteryServiceDumpProto.BATTERY_PLUGGED_WIRELESS;
            }
            proto.write(BatteryServiceDumpProto.PLUGGED, batteryPluggedValue);
            proto.write(BatteryServiceDumpProto.MAX_CHARGING_CURRENT, mBatteryProps.maxChargingCurrent);
            proto.write(BatteryServiceDumpProto.MAX_CHARGING_VOLTAGE, mBatteryProps.maxChargingVoltage);
            proto.write(BatteryServiceDumpProto.CHARGE_COUNTER, mBatteryProps.batteryChargeCounter);
            proto.write(BatteryServiceDumpProto.STATUS, mBatteryProps.batteryStatus);
            proto.write(BatteryServiceDumpProto.HEALTH, mBatteryProps.batteryHealth);
            proto.write(BatteryServiceDumpProto.IS_PRESENT, mBatteryProps.batteryPresent);
            proto.write(BatteryServiceDumpProto.LEVEL, mBatteryProps.batteryLevel);
            proto.write(BatteryServiceDumpProto.SCALE, BATTERY_SCALE);
            proto.write(BatteryServiceDumpProto.VOLTAGE, mBatteryProps.batteryVoltage);
            proto.write(BatteryServiceDumpProto.TEMPERATURE, mBatteryProps.batteryTemperature);
            proto.write(BatteryServiceDumpProto.TECHNOLOGY, mBatteryProps.batteryTechnology);
        }
        proto.flush();
    }
